1.首先新建一个JPA工程:
2.写好工程名字,点下一步,再下一步,如果第一次建JPA工程也许会卡在下面这个界面上,提示要选User library, 点击红圈处的下载,选择对应你Eclipse的那个,我的是kepler(启动eclipse时的界面上可以看到),勾选上,然后finish:
3.这是一个写好的例子,先看看工程结构:
4.beans包下的User类(创建方式:右键包名 - > New - > JPA Entity):
其中 @Table是设置该类关联的数据库表名
@Id是主键
5.dao包下的操作类:
6.test包下的测试类:
7.配置文件persistence.xml (在META-INF目录下):
8.这里用的数据库是mysql ,由于没有设置自动生成表,在mysql中先手动创建了表User(name varchar(10) primary key, pwd varchar(20)),另外记得添加mysql的驱动包到工程中。